#067825 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#067825 is composed of 2.4% red, 47.1%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.2%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 136.3 degrees, a saturation of 90.5% and a lightness of 24.7%. #067825 color hex could be obtained by blending #0cf04a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

Shades and Tints of #067825
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000802 is the darkest color, while #f4fef7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#067825
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3b433d is the less saturated color, while #017d23 is the most saturated one.
